Transaction 5faed86f03f26fc3f1a3950a38a99360d4591bf61479333d62e28b72ff2d05f4

1 Input
2 Outputs
  • 5faed86f03f26fc3f1a3950a38a99360d4591bf61479333d62e28b72ff2d05f4:0
  • value  29109630
    address  157cEbQTm87iMuJaZjBWRDJfLVqo1RNniq
  • 5faed86f03f26fc3f1a3950a38a99360d4591bf61479333d62e28b72ff2d05f4:1
  • value  24830370
    address  144bQdppEknC55uCmeSyS3TC8VfMYsNyrf